Expect traffic delays with high school graduations on campus

Coors Events Center

Each year the University of Colorado Boulder hosts several high school graduations at Coors Events Conference Center throughout the month of May. This year we welcome nine high school graduating classes from Monday, May 15, through the next Friday, May 26.

During each high school graduation, public parking for attendees will be available around the Coors Center. View the event parking areas map. Parking lots and roadways may be crowded as you are leaving or returning from lunch and/or the end of your business day.

Alternative methods of transportation are encouraged to avoid traffic impacts during these times. To view RTD busing information, visit the Parking and Transportation bus routes page.
